Model GSD3620Z02BB - The normal cycle will not engage when the knob is turned. The short cycle will engage (sound like it is working) but the soap is left in the reservoir and about 2 inches of water is left in the bottom. Thank you for your help.

Sounds like the selector switch has gone bad. The machine is not fully cycling thru and draining because the selector isn't proceeding like it should.
This typically happens if the selector dial is spun real hard repeatedly over time. The little cogs inside of the selector will get broken and sometimes the broken parts will lodge inside the switch and cause jams.

GE washing machine water overflowing

sound like the same washing machine from hell that we have. three or four times it has overflowed from want we have been told the hose that runs from the drum to on/off pressure switch cloggeds with soap. we have tried different soap,hot water,cold,water you name it we've tried it. so now evey time we use it we have to clean it with a coat hanger by taking the front off the machine.

P.S. take the hose off top and bottom to clean it, all it takes two/three very small soap bubbles to clogged it
